Abstract
PURPOSE:To eliminate influence of interference light from a specimen-atomizing device, by impressing atomic steam onto magnetic field and also by analyzing element by measuring time variation in amount of magnetic movement at the time when strength of light applied to the atomic steam is changed. CONSTITUTION:A burner chamber 4, which is a specimen-atomizing unit, is supplied with fuel gas and auxiliary fuel gas through a gas inlet 6 and an auxiliary gas inlet 5. The burner chamber 4 is provided in its inside with an atomizing device, and by supplying this device with auxiliary fuel gas, a specimen 3 for analysis is sucked up, atomized and introduced into flame 7. The flame 7 is provided with magnets 8 and 9, and a static magnetic field of 4-15kG level is impressed onto atomic vapor in the flame 7. A light source 10 radiates light having the same wave length as that of a resonant absorption wire of the atomic vapor, and it is connected and disconnected by a rotary sector 12 having plural openings in circumferential direction, and after the light is collected by a lens 11, it is applied to the flame 7.
